What is Grammarly?

Grammarly is an AI writing assistance company, boasting users among over 30 million people and 70,000 professional teams. From creating a first draft to perfecting messages, Grammarly helps users to get their point across without compromising security or privacy. Grammarly’s product offerings—Grammarly Free, Grammarly Premium, Grammarly Business, and Grammarly for Education—deliver contextually relevant writing support across over 500,000 apps and websites.

Real-time analysis feature: Users have appreciated Grammarly's real-time analysis feature, which suggests and corrects word usage in a specific context. Many users have found this to be a valuable proofreading tool that provides reliable and accurate suggestions for improving their writing.

Highly accurate spell check: Grammarly's spell check feature has received praise from users for its high accuracy in identifying common spelling mistakes, grammatical errors, and syntactic errors. Several reviewers have found this feature to be helpful in ensuring error-free writing.

Tone detection capability: Users highly value Grammarly's ability to detect the tone of their writing, which helps them ensure that their text sounds friendly and professional. This feature is seen as valuable by many users in maintaining the desired tone in their communication.

Expensive Pricing: Some users have found Grammarly to be expensive and feel that the pricing is not very apparent, leading to confusion.

Performance and Functionality Issues: Users have experienced various issues with Grammarly's performance and functionality. These include the software not guaranteeing 100% correctness, failing to remove marked errors even after corrections, and facing problems with plagiarism detection in the MS Office version.

Confusing User Interface: The user interface of Grammarly has received criticism from some users who find it confusing and mention that it can get in the way of their workflow. They also note that the UX can be slow, leading to frustration, and that the software can hog memory and slow down their computer.

Hemmingway. This is what I used before starting with Grammarly. The user interface might not be that great, but the best part is, it is free and even the premium version is way cheaper than Grammarly. You can also choose to turn off real-time suggestions and corrections. It can also be used offline, unlike Grammarly. The downside of Hemmingway is that it doesn’t check for the tone and style in writing.

The closest alternative I could find is Linguix which is also great. The biggest advantage Linguix has over Grammarly at this time is being able to save templates onto hotkeys to quickly paste redundant emails and texts. However, I prefer Grammarly for real-time proofreading because it has better spelling and grammatical insight. Also, everything is conveniently shown on the side panel and broken down into categories (along with an overall score). Linguix currently does not have these features.
